Hardwood Installation in Denton, TX
Hardwood installation services involve the professional setup of wooden flooring materials across various areas of a home or property. This service covers projects such as replacing existing floors, expanding living spaces with new hardwood surfaces, or upgrading older flooring to achieve a more polished and durable look. Property owners typically want to understand the types of hardwood options available, including solid and engineered wood, as well as the installation process, durability, and maintenance requirements to ensure the flooring meets their aesthetic and functional needs.
Before requesting hardwood installation, property owners often consider factors like the room’s usage, foot traffic levels, and the existing subfloor condition. It’s also important to understand the different finishes, stain options, and how the flooring will complement the overall interior design. Clarifying these details can help ensure the chosen hardwood flooring aligns with the property’s style and long-term performance expectations.

Common Hardwood Installation Jobs
Hardwood Floor Installation - provides a durable and attractive surface for living areas and hallways.
Pre-Finished Hardwood Installation - offers quick installation with minimal disruption and immediate use.
Solid Hardwood Flooring - adds timeless appeal and can be sanded and refinished multiple times.
Engineered Hardwood Installation - suitable for areas with moisture concerns or below-grade spaces.
Custom Hardwood Patterns - creates unique designs to enhance the aesthetic of any room.
Subfloor Preparation - ensures a stable foundation for long-lasting hardwood flooring.
Hardwood Installation Questions
What types of hardwood flooring are available for installation? There are various options including oak, maple, hickory, and exotic woods, each offering different looks and durability levels suited for residential or commercial spaces.
Can hardwood flooring be installed over existing floors? Yes, in some cases, hardwood can be installed over existing flooring if the surface is stable and level, but it may require preparation or specific installation methods.
What should property owners consider before choosing hardwood flooring? Factors like the room's usage, moisture levels, and overall style preferences help determine the best hardwood type and finish for the space.
Are there different installation methods for hardwood flooring? Yes, common methods include nail-down, glue-down, and floating installations, each suitable for different subfloor types and project requirements.
